In this guided tour you will discover one of the most emblematic monuments of Paris and symbol of France, the Eiffel Tower, project of the architect Gustavo Eiffel for the Universal Exhibition of 1889. The "Iron Lady", as it is affectionately called, dominates the capital with its 324 meters high.

We will start our guided tour at the exit of the Trocadero subway. From the terrace of the Trocadero you will marvel at the magnificent view of the Eiffel Tower, then we will walk towards the Eiffel Tower, we will pass by the beautiful Fountain of Warsaw located in the gardens of the Trocadero.

Then we will use the elevators to climb to the top of the Eiffel Tower from where you will enjoy an extraordinary 360 ° view over Paris. From there, I will show you the most outstanding monuments in the Parisian urban landscape.
